University at Albany faculty attracted $391.7 million in research funding in 2007-2008, an all-time high and a reflection of the breadth and global impact of UAlbany research and scholarship.
The University at Albany is one of the nation's leading public academic and research institutions, and your support plays a crucial role in sustaining this tradition of excellence. We proudly recognize contributions to the University through the following giving societies...

THE TRADITIONSGifts of all sizes can make a difference, and we recognize UAlbany alumni and friends who give at the following levels through clubs named in honor of some of the University's most enduring images. |

THE 1844 SOCIETYThe 1844 Society recognizes donors who give annual gifts to any of the University's colleges, schools or programs at or above the leadership level of $1,000. |

THE EXCELSIOR CIRCLEAs one of the flagship university centers for the State of New York, UAlbany honors our alumni and friends in the Excelsior Circle who support the University with annual gifts, endowment and capital project contributions of $25,000 or more in the shared pursuit of a "strong, bright and ever better future." |
